Viewed: 74 - Published at: 3 years agoIngredients
- 1 medium onions chopped
- 4 large garlic cloves minced
- 1/2 cup red wine stock, or water
- 28 ounces tomatoes, canned, crushed
- 4 cups water or stock
- 1 each green bell peppers diced
- 2 Stalks celery diced
- 2 cups okra sliced
- 2 teaspoons ginger fresh, finely minced
- 1 teaspoon oregano dried
- 1tsp thyme
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- 1 teaspoon cumin ground
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
- 1 cup zucchini diced
- 15 ounces black beans with liquid
- 1-2 tablespoons soy sauce, tamari
- 4 cups brown rice cooked
Method
- Braise the onion and garlic in wine until onion is soft.
- Add tomatoes, water, green pepper, celery, okra, ginger, and seasonings; simmer for 15 minutes.
- Add the diced zucchini and the black beans with their liquid, cover and cook until the zucchini is just tender, about 10 minutes.
- Add soy sauce to taste.
- Serve over cooked brown rice.
